#564ebf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#564ebf is composed of 33.7% red, 30.6%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55% cyan, 59.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 244.2 degrees, a saturation of 46.9% and a lightness of 52.7%. #564ebf color hex could be obtained by blending #ac9cff with #00007f.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#564ebf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#564ebf has RGB values of R:86, G:78, B:191 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0.59,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 5656255.
